Integral Ad Science announces that it has earned Media Rating Council (MRC) accreditation for its invalid traffic (SIVT) filtration in the Connected TV (CTV) environment.

Last year, IAS received the industry’s first accreditation for CTV video viewable impressions. With this announcement, IAS expands its portfolio of MRC-accredited metrics to include SIVT filtration of CTV video viewable impressions.

“This accreditation marks our continued commitment to transparency and quality in the CTV space and further demonstrates our position as a leader in providing accredited products and services to our clients. As marketers allocate increased spend towards CTV and OTT to reach audiences, it is increasingly important to ensure these environments are protected from fraud,” Kevin Alvero, chief compliance officer, IAS  said.

The full scope of the accreditation covers IAS’s SIVT filtration and reporting in CTV environments as applied to video impressions, viewable impressions, and related viewability metrics.

“IAS is to be congratulated for the longstanding commitment to quality measurement it has demonstrated through its engagement in the MRC’s accreditation process. This new accreditation is especially critical to marketers as they continue to grow their investments in CTV channels,” George W. Ivie, executive director and CEO, MRC, said.
